An Explanatory Study to Assess the English Language Adaptation on BSc Fresher Students among Hindi Medium Students in Selected Nursing Colleges at Indore, MP.

Supriya Chinnam [2]


Abstract: Title of the study: Adaptation of English language for Hindi medium fresher of BSc nursing students: An explanatory study. Background: Students are the key assets of colleges & universities. The student?s performance plays an important role in producing the best quality graduates who will become great leaders and manpower for the country. Nursing as a healthcare profession is focused on the care of individuals, families, and communities so that they may attain, maintain, or recover optimal health and quality of life. There are various reasons for unsatisfactory academic performance among nursing students such as lack of parental guidance, language barrier, academic factors, personal factors, college - related factors, etc. The researcher had chosen the present problem to assess the adaptation of language from Hindi medium students. A nurse must adopt a full - fledged design with a similar usage of language. Eventually, they adopt systemic terms which is not close language. The family economic conditions and facilities of nearby maximum students prefer to educate themselves towards available free education, its effect on their future but, some of the students dare to easily adopt of English language and learn medical vocab. Despite their situations, they shine themselves and are ready to beat the language barrier of academics. Introduction: Nurses work in a large variety of specialties where they work independently and as part of a team to assess the plan, implementation, and evaluation the patient care. A student nurse also has certain responsibilities. A candidate with the right acumen will be able to develop into a knowledgeable professional with the finest set of patient care skills. Studies have shown that better academic performance in junior college may effective criterion that requires the understanding of the language factor that influences academic performance in the initial stage of education. Knowledge about these factors is also paramount in developing strategies for adopting the English language and its further barriers. Aim: The study aimed to explain the adoption of the English language to those who have a Hindi medium background and compare the fresher and 6 months of their academic level of improvement in medical and normal English language. Design: This study used an explanatory study design with MCQs. The multiple ? choice questions were developed to explore the importance of seeking the English language. Settings: Site selection was purposive to ensure representation across the 1st year of BSc nursing from Hindi medium students. Participants: Those came from Hindi medium to do BSc nursing. The study was conducted on 20 sample students of BSc Nursing freshers. It was found that those who have a Hindi medium background students regarding their interest in English language adoption at BSc Nursing Colleges in Indore. Results: The results of the study showed that there was enough adaptation. It demonstrates less excellent and nervousness towards education and fears fullness of their academic success. Overall, for 20 participants. Initially, the adoptive responses were divided into scores as strongly agree, agree, disagree, and strongly disagree. Even language does not impact students further. Conclusion: Fresher students can understand and adopt the English language as part of their exclusive contribution to clinical communication and future opportunities. After 6 months of academic maximum Hindi medium students were aware of language with a basic and advanced language seeking. At the end of the study, the English language does not affect on future.
